Following reaction shows the preparation of
Nitrile from
Amide. In this reaction
Thionyl Chloride (SOCl₂)is reacted with Amide, which produced nitrile along with
SO₂ and
HCl gas. The
importance of this reaction is the removal of byproducts (i.e SO₂ and HCl). As both SO₂ and HCl are
gases so no extra workup is required to remove them. The
